Malware Insights

MITRE ATT&CK
T1059.001 JavaScript/JScript T1027 Obfuscated Files or Information

The PDF file contains embedded JavaScript, indicated by the PDF_JAVASCRIPT and PDF_JS heuristics. The PDF_EVAL heuristic firing suggests that the JavaScript code is being executed using eval(), a common technique for obfuscation. The deobfuscated JavaScript file 'acroform_b64_00.js' was extracted, and its presence, along with the obfuscation indicators, strongly suggests the script is designed to download and execute a secondary payload. The lack of specific IOCs like URLs or hashes in the provided evidence prevents a more precise attribution or identification of the payload.

Heuristics 5

  • eval() call high PDF_EVAL
    eval() found — commonly used for obfuscated exploit execution (matched inside decoded stream)
  • JavaScript action low PDF_JAVASCRIPT
    PDF contains a /JavaScript action. Generic JavaScript is common in benign forms; specific dangerous APIs are scored by separate rules.
  • Embedded JS stream low PDF_JS
    PDF references a /JS stream. Generic JavaScript is common in benign forms; specific dangerous APIs are scored by separate rules.
  • String.fromCharCode low PDF_FROMCHARCODE
    String.fromCharCode found — used to construct payload strings dynamically. Common in benign JavaScript libraries for codepoint manipulation, so this alone is informational; weaponised use is also caught by the dedicated fromCharCode-stage and exploit-shape rules. (matched inside decoded stream)
  • Suspicious extracted artifact info EXTRACTED_FILE_STATIC_TRIAGE
    One or more files extracted from inside this sample matched static suspicious-content checks such as script obfuscation, encoded payload blobs, packed data, or execution/download terms.
